Method

For the Butter Poached Grouper

  1. 1

    Prepare the Butter

    In a saucepan, melt the unsalted butter over low heat until fully melted. Add salt, pepper, and lemon juice. Keep warm but do not let it boil.

  2. 2

    Poach the Grouper

    Submerge the grouper fillets in the warm butter, ensuring they are fully covered. Poach for about 10-12 minutes, or until the fish is opaque and flakes easily with a fork.

For the Truffle Celeriac Puree

  1. 3

    Cook the Celeriac

    Place the diced celeriac in a pot of salted boiling water. Cook until tender, about 15-20 minutes. Drain well.

  2. 4

    Blend the Puree

    In a blender, combine the cooked celeriac, heavy cream, truffle oil, salt, and pepper. Blend until smooth and creamy. Adjust seasoning if necessary.

For the Arugula Fennel Salad

  1. 5

    Prepare the Salad

    In a large bowl, combine arugula and sliced fennel. Drizzle with olive oil and lemon juice. Toss to coat evenly. Season with salt and pepper to taste.

Assembly

  1. 6

    Serve the Dish

    On each plate, place a generous scoop of truffle celeriac puree, top with poached grouper, and serve a side of arugula fennel salad.
